Job Description

Apple's Platform Architecture group develops the next generation of Apple hardware, and the tools to make it possible. Our team builds high-performance verification systems that accelerate the development of Apple silicon.

We aim to push the boundaries of pre-silicon validation with simulation solutions that apply and extend principles from hardware emulation. We are seeking an engineer to develop and deploy agentic AI workflows that automate and optimize pre-silicon validation processes.

In this role, you will bridge the gap between applied artificial intelligence and Electronic Design Automation (EDA), building autonomous agents that triage errors, tune simulation parameters, and drastically reduce maintenance burdens for silicon verification teams.

Description In this role, you will focus on AI based automations, infrastructure development, and continuous experimentation at the intersection of hardware design and verification.

Responsibilities

Design and deploy autonomous AI agents to review design changes, resolve conflicts, and triage elaboration and simulation errors. Develop AI-driven workflows to flag simulation performance and design concerns, automatically tune design parameters, and explore optimization candidates autonomously.

Apply internal and external EDA tools (e. g. , Logic Equivalence Checking, wave dumps, design libraries) to automatically diagnose issues and explore design alternatives. Build and maintain AI harnesses, scripts, and infrastructure to support continuous research and experimentation.

Conduct data-driven experimentation to optimize prompts and harnesses; measure and improve token efficiency, task completion, and hallucination rates. Track and evaluate emerging machine learning and Large Language Model (LLM) use cases in the broader industry for application in silicon design workflows.
